Day 3-1: Palmer v Willstrop & Beachill v White $27.95

WILLSTROP VS PALMER: James Willstrop made another claim to greatness tonight when he not only beat David Palmer, he took him apart in three games. Willstrop was clinical in his dissection and breathtaking in his winning shots, played at a speed that defied belief. I had my nose a foot from the front wall and I saw sights I have never seen before. Willstrop screaming to the front wall and managing to perform the most perfect cross court drop into the nick.

WHITE vs BEACHILL: John White was only in third gear against Lee Beachill but it was still fast enough to win in four. He lost the first game quickly but forced the second to four deuces to win 10-9 in almost 19 minutes. He took a quick third game 9-2 and once more held off the Beachill challenge to win the fourth 10-8. But his efforts were not good enough to get him a final berth, so he will face Nicol in the third place playoff.

SCORELINES:

James Willstrop (Eng) bt David Palmer (Aus) 9-7, 9-5, 9-7 (27 mins)
John White (Sco) bt Lee Beachill (Eng) 5-9, 10-8, 9-2, 10-8 (55 mins)

All recorded from rear of the court in high fidelity; no narration but with voice of referee.
